Details
The article highlights several key AI developments. Tubi has become the first streaming service to offer a native app integration within ChatGPT, allowing users to access the service directly through the popular AI chatbot. The article also discusses the growing importance of LLM-referred traffic, which can convert at 30-40%, yet most enterprises are not optimizing for it. The new AI agent platform Poke aims to make AI agents accessible to everyday users via text message. AWS's investments in both Anthropic and OpenAI, despite being competitors, are explained as part of the cloud giant's approach to handling competition. Finally, Block has introduced Managerbot, an AI agent embedded in the Square platform that proactively monitors a seller's business and proposes solutions.
